Tenth Stakes-Winner for Nicconi

Tara Madgwick - Sunday March 5
Second in the Group III MRC Chairman's Stakes to subsequent Blue Diamond winner Catchy, promising Nicconi filly Time Awaits tasted stakes success of her own at Morphettville on Saturday when taking out the Listed SAJC Cinderella Stakes.

NicconiPrepared by Tony McEvoy, Time Awaits finished too well for Snitzel filly Spoils to win the 1050 metre sprint by half a neck with I Am Invincible filly Pageantry in third place.

Entered for several feature races at The Championships in Sydney next month, Time Awaits has now won two races and over $125,000 in prizemoney from just four starts.

Bred by Pipeliner Bloodstock and retained to race in partnership, Time Awaits is the first foal of placed Danzero mare Bon Ton, a daughter of Group II WATC Oaks winner Mystic Chantry.

Time Awaits is the tenth stakes-winner for Widden Stud's popular quiet achiever Nicconi, who covered his biggest ever book of mares in 2016.

226 mares visited Nicconi last spring at a fee of $11,000.
